Ok. I was just playing the SOF2 MP Demo when I got a random restart. Also I noticed some strange textures in the game (colored walls) almost as if I OCed the vid card (which I do not do anymore and haven't done on this system). I decided to lower the voltage to 1.6 volts instead of 1.625. I load up windows and PC Alert 4 is reporting a vcore of 1.65-1.69 volts (it varies). What is going on? CPU temps are still 50-60 celcius. I am running 200x11 on a 2500+ Mobile. Is this normal? Why isn't the vcore 1.600 like I said in BIOS?

Also I would also like to know the stock voltage for this CPU for reference (1.5volts? 1.45?) as I may try to take it down even more even if i have to sacrifice 100mhz.
 
software probes and bios probes are very inaccurate.

The only way to tell what the true voltage your cpu is getting, is by using a multimeter
